Output d4f601b23f4a5aa1924b16e42057195cf1e5021306547768b9581c6e679aebb6:1

value
78658622
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5430dfb1b02a156381ea1227844c30620c57374a OP_EQUALVERIFY OP_CHECKSIG
address
18gAJvfawFGFTFUUF2bMWmRRk1SrvnDYhx
transaction
d4f601b23f4a5aa1924b16e42057195cf1e5021306547768b9581c6e679aebb6
spent
true